Output eb68856e38577c2c806ae267cafd02b72f22e4b316176b1a237f442c0c7c3a8c:0
- value
- 21007821398
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89391d0e43873c06bca9cdeddf638ec7e27be28c OP_EQUALVERIFY OP_CHECKSIG
- address
- DHefXrXPuuebyoCYW5az9tKVtAET8N6Ed9
- transaction
- eb68856e38577c2c806ae267cafd02b72f22e4b316176b1a237f442c0c7c3a8c